Membaca dan menyimpan streaming data

Setelah mulai menyerap data streaming ke dalam aplikasi yang di-deploy, Anda dapat melihat output streaming.

Membaca output streaming

Setelah berhasil membuat aplikasi yang menyimpan hasil ke dalam streaming, Anda dapat membaca streaming input sumber data atau streaming output stream.

Gemini Enterprise Agent Platform Vision SDK

Untuk mengirim permintaan untuk membaca streaming output model, Anda harus menginstal Gemini Enterprise Agent Platform Vision SDK.

Lakukan penggantian variabel berikut:

  • PROJECT_ID: Project ID Anda Google Cloud .
  • LOCATION_ID: ID lokasi Anda. Contohnya, us-central1. Region yang didukung. Informasi selengkapnya.
  • STREAM_ID: ID streaming yang Anda buat di cluster Contohnya, application-output-1234abcd.

Mencetak konten streaming:

# This will print packets from a stream to stdout.
# This will work for *any* stream, independent of the data type.
vaictl -p PROJECT_ID \
         -l LOCATION_ID \
         -c application-cluster-0 \
         --service-endpoint visionai.googleapis.com \
receive streams packets STREAM_ID

Menyimpan video dari streaming

Gunakan perintah berikut untuk menyimpan output streaming video. Perintah ini membaca data dari streaming langsung yang sedang berlangsung, dan menyimpan segmen video dalam format file MP4 ke direktori output yang ditentukan pengguna:

Gemini Enterprise Agent Platform Vision SDK

Untuk mengirim permintaan untuk menyimpan output video dari streaming, Anda harus menginstal Gemini Enterprise Agent Platform Vision SDK.

Lakukan penggantian variabel berikut:

  • PROJECT_ID: Project ID Anda Google Cloud .
  • LOCATION_ID: ID lokasi Anda. Contohnya, us-central1. Region yang didukung. Informasi selengkapnya.
  • STREAM_ID: ID streaming yang Anda buat di cluster Contohnya, application-output-1234abcd.
  • OUTPUT_PATH: Jalur video output. Nilai defaultnya adalah /tmp/.
vaictl -p PROJECT_ID \
         -l LOCATION_ID \
         -c application-cluster-0 \
         --service-endpoint visionai.googleapis.com \
receive streams video-file STREAM_ID --output OUTPUT_PATH